- // S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-only
- /*
- * dir.c
- *
- * PURPOSE
- * Directory handling routines for the OSTA-UDF(tm) filesystem.
- *
- * COPYRIGHT
- * (C) 1998-2004 Ben Fennema
- *
- * HISTORY
- *
- * 10/05/98 dgb Split directory operations into its own file
- * Implemented directory reads via do_udf_readdir
- * 10/06/98 Made directory operations work!
- * 11/17/98 Rewrote directory to support ICBTAG_FLAG_AD_LONG
- * 11/25/98 blf Rewrote directory handling (readdir+lookup) to support reading
- * across blocks.
- * 12/12/98 Split out the lookup code to namei.c. bulk of directory
- * code now in directory.c:udf_fileident_read.
- */
- #include "udfdecl.h"
- #include <linux/string.h>
- #include <linux/errno.h>
- #include <linux/filelock.h>
- #include <linux/mm.h>
- #include <linux/slab.h>
- #include <linux/bio.h>
- #include <linux/iversion.h>
- #include "udf_i.h"
- #include "udf_sb.h"
- static int udf_readdir(struct file *file, struct dir_context *ctx)
- {
- struct inode *dir = file_inode(file);
- loff_t nf_pos, emit_pos = 0;
- int flen;
- unsigned char *fname = NULL;
- int ret = 0;
- struct super_block *sb = dir->i_sb;
- bool pos_valid = false;
- struct udf_fileident_iter iter;
- if (ctx->pos == 0) {
- if (!dir_emit_dot(file, ctx))
- return 0;
- ctx->pos = 1;
- }
- nf_pos = (ctx->pos - 1) << 2;
- if (nf_pos >= dir->i_size)
- goto out;
- /*
- * Something changed since last readdir (either lseek was called or dir
- * changed)? We need to verify the position correctly points at the
- * beginning of some dir entry so that the directory parsing code does
- * not get confused. Since UDF does not have any reliable way of
- * identifying beginning of dir entry (names are under user control),
- * we need to scan the directory from the beginning.
- */
- if (!inode_eq_iversion(dir, *(u64 *)file->private_data)) {
- emit_pos = nf_pos;
- nf_pos = 0;
- } else {
- pos_valid = true;
- }
- fname = kmalloc(UDF_NAME_LEN, GFP_KERNEL);
- if (!fname) {
- ret = -ENOMEM;
- goto out;
- }
- for (ret = udf_fiiter_init(&iter, dir, nf_pos);
- !ret && iter.pos < dir->i_size;
- ret = udf_fiiter_advance(&iter)) {
- struct kernel_lb_addr tloc;
- udf_pblk_t iblock;
- /* Still not at offset where user asked us to read from? */
- if (iter.pos < emit_pos)
- continue;
- /* Update file position only if we got past the current one */
- pos_valid = true;
- ctx->pos = (iter.pos >> 2) + 1;
- if (iter.fi.fileCharacteristics & FID_FILE_CHAR_DELETED) {
- if (!UDF_QUERY_FLAG(sb, UDF_FLAG_UNDELETE))
- continue;
- }
- if (iter.fi.fileCharacteristics & FID_FILE_CHAR_HIDDEN) {
- if (!UDF_QUERY_FLAG(sb, UDF_FLAG_UNHIDE))
- continue;
- }
- if (iter.fi.fileCharacteristics & FID_FILE_CHAR_PARENT) {
- if (!dir_emit_dotdot(file, ctx))
- goto out_iter;
- continue;
- }
- flen = udf_get_filename(sb, iter.name,
- iter.fi.lengthFileIdent, fname, UDF_NAME_LEN);
- if (flen < 0)
- continue;
- tloc = lelb_to_cpu(iter.fi.icb.extLocation);
- iblock = udf_get_lb_pblock(sb, &tloc, 0);
- if (!dir_emit(ctx, fname, flen, iblock, DT_UNKNOWN))
- goto out_iter;
- }
- if (!ret) {
- ctx->pos = (iter.pos >> 2) + 1;
- pos_valid = true;
- }
- out_iter:
- udf_fiiter_release(&iter);
- out:
- if (pos_valid)
- *(u64 *)file->private_data = inode_query_iversion(dir);
- kfree(fname);
- return ret;
- }
- static int udf_dir_open(struct inode *inode, struct file *file)
- {
- file->private_data = kzalloc(sizeof(u64), GFP_KERNEL);
- if (!file->private_data)
- return -ENOMEM;
- return 0;
- }
- static int udf_dir_release(struct inode *inode, struct file *file)
- {
- kfree(file->private_data);
- return 0;
- }
- static loff_t udf_dir_llseek(struct file *file, loff_t offset, int whence)
- {
- return generic_llseek_cookie(file, offset, whence,
- (u64 *)file->private_data);
- }
- /* readdir and lookup functions */
- const struct file_operations udf_dir_operations = {
- .open = udf_dir_open,
- .release = udf_dir_release,
- .llseek = udf_dir_llseek,
- .read = generic_read_dir,
- .iterate_shared = udf_readdir,
- .unlocked_ioctl = udf_ioctl,
- .fsync = generic_file_fsync,
- .setlease = generic_setlease,
- };
